  • The timed unit of silence The five most common rests values are whole rests, half rests, quarter rests, eighth rests, and sixteenth rests The length of rests is based upon ratios Whole rests last twice as long as half rests, which last twice as long as quarter rests, which last twice as long as eighth rests, which last twice as long as sixteenth rests Rhythmic Values.

  • A contradictory word here as it does nothing but increase your tension Interest rates are quotes on a daily rest, monthly rest or annual rest basis The annual rest quote implies that the company gives you the credit for the monthly principal repayments only at the end of each year Such loans are therefore more expensive than a monthly/daily rest loan The shorter the tenure of the loan, the greater the effective interest rate difference will be.
